cd drive

I went back to the oldest version I had, I believe it was 3.4, opened it and had it recognize my cd drive that I use to load a disk at a show (mine is D drive) and saved it.
I then closed that version and re-opened 4.8 and hit cancel when it ask for a default drive and mine started working when I want to import/load someones disk at a show.
Prior to opening the older version and saving the (D) default drive I could not get mine to work in 4.8.
I believe the "key" is to saving the drive in the older version.
Hope this helps.

Folks, the main problem here for those experiencing this is for some reason the registry entries that define the drive are not getting updated. These same registry keys are used by both 3.4 and 4.08.
This is why I said to go into 3.4 and try the Detect Again button in the drive tool. If it detects it as good there and you "Save" the information, close 3.4 and then open 4.08 theoretically this should set the registry keys to show the drive as good. If this doesn't happen then for some reason Hoster isn't being allowed to change the registry.
If it works then you will not see the Set Drive window pop up at the start up of 4.08 and if it doesn't then you will still get the pop-up. However as some have discovered including MadJim if you hit Cancel when it shows a "BAD" drive, then the drive will work anyway.
MTU is looking at this and if they find a quick fix for it they will release a 4.08a and you will have to "upgrade" again.
